In 2007, the local newspaper in Knoxville, Tennessee, ran a contest to select Community Columnists to write monthly opinion columns on regional issues of importance and concern to citizens in the Greater Knoxville area.At the urging of my wife, Lisa, I submitted an entry, and the editors of the Knoxville News Sentinel selected me as one of eight finalists from nearly 100 submissions. With a circulation of over 150,000 subscribers, I embraced both the excitement and nervousness that such a large readership might induce. I had never expressed my written opinions on such a scale before. This book is a collection of the twelve essays I wrote for this opportunity from 2007 to 2008, along with commentary about my experience. I also include some additional essays that have yet to be published.My hope is that the reader will gain insight into Knoxville politics and history and be challenged to become a writer, too.
